American Sign Language (ASL), visual-gestural language used by most of the deaf community in the United States and Canada. David Corina, in Handbook of Neurolinguistics, 1998. 21-1 ASL AND THE DEAF COMMUNITY. American Sign Language is the language used by most of the Deaf 1 community in North America. ASL is a natural language, autonomous from English. ASL is only one of the many sign languages of the world, but it is the one that has been the most extensively studied.

Sign Language appeared as a language for the first time beginning in the mid-1960s when Stoke, Casterline, and Croneberg published the Dictionary of American Sign Language on Linguistic Principles. This event gave linguistic recognition to ASL for the first time in its history, although very few people recognized the event as significant.
